A140735 Triangle read by rows, X^n * [1,0,0,0,...]; where X = a tridiagonal matrix with (1,2,3,...) in the main diagonal and (1,1,1,...) in the sub and subsubdiagonals. +0
3
1, 1, 1, 1, 1, 3, 5, 2, 1, 1, 7, 19, 16, 12, 3, 1, 1, 15, 65, 90, 95, 46, 22, 4, 1, 1, 31, 211, 440, 630, 461, 295, 100, 35, 5, 1, 1, 63, 665, 2002, 3801, 3836, 3156, 1556, 710, 185, 51, 6, 1, 1, 127, 2059, 8736, 21672, 28819, 29729, 19440, 11102, 4116, 1456, 308, 70 (list; table; graph; listen)

EXAMPLE

First few rows of the triangle are:

1;

1, 1, 1;

1, 3, 5, 2, 1;

1, 7, 19, 16, 12, 3, 1;

1, 15, 65, 90, 95, 46, 22, 4, 1;

1, 31, 211, 440, 630, 461, 295, 100, 35, 5, 1;

1, 63, 665, 2002, 3801, 3836, 3156, 1556, 710, 185, 51, 6, 1;

...
